|
Stock-based compensation - Equity Plans and Activity (Details)
|1 Months Ended
|12 Months Ended
|36 Months Ended
|72 Months Ended
|
Feb. 29, 2012
shares
|
Sep. 30, 2023
shares
|
Feb. 29, 2020
shares
|
Dec. 31, 2018
shares
|
Jun. 30, 2018
shares
|
Dec. 31, 2023
item
shares
|
Dec. 31, 2017
shares
|
Dec. 31, 2016
shares
|
Dec. 31, 2018
shares
|
Dec. 31, 2018
shares
|
Dec. 31, 2021
shares
|
May 19, 2020
shares
|
Dec. 18, 2018
shares
|
Dec. 31, 2014
shares
|Stock-based compensation
|Number of Equity Compensation Plans | item
|2
|Stock options
|Stock-based compensation
|Granted (in shares)
|1,177,750
|Forfeited/cancelled (in shares)
|62,831
|Expired (in shares)
|12,665
|Restricted stock units
|Stock-based compensation
|Granted (in shares)
|108,058
|Forfeited (in shares)
|5,477
|Vested (in shares)
|66,201
|Inducement Award Program
|Stock-based compensation
|Number of shares reserved
|62,500
|Additional number of shares authorized for issuance
|500,000
|104,166
|141,666
|208,333
|48,333
|Shares available for future grants
|482,667
|Reduction of shares available for issuance
|169,447
|Inducement Award Program | Stock options
|Stock-based compensation
|Granted (in shares)
|825,562
|Forfeited/cancelled (in shares)
|472,880
|Expired (in shares)
|1,997
|Exercised (in shares)
|48,663
|Inducement Award Program | Restricted stock units
|Stock-based compensation
|Granted (in shares)
|80,804
|Vested (in shares)
|30,128
|Equity Incentive Plan 2021 [Member]
|Stock-based compensation
|Number of shares reserved
|1,991,666
|Shares available for future grants
|693,645
|Equity Incentive Plan 2021 [Member] | Stock options
|Stock-based compensation
|Granted (in shares)
|1,398,762
|Exercised (in shares)
|0
|Forfeited (in shares)
|52,013
|Equity Incentive Plan 2021 [Member] | Restricted stock units
|Stock-based compensation
|Granted (in shares)
|269,349
|Forfeited (in shares)
|18,594
|Vested (in shares)
|80,367
|2012 Plan
|Stock-based compensation
|Number of shares reserved
|285,714
|1,104,177
|1,083,333
|1,385,702
|Additional number of shares authorized for issuance
|2,508
|107,412
|Percentage of outstanding shares of common stock used to compute annual increase in number of shares reserved
|4.00%
|2012 Plan | Maximum
|Stock-based compensation
|Annual increase in number of shares reserved
|107,412
|2012 Plan | Stock options
|Stock-based compensation
|Granted (in shares)
|1,841,188
|Forfeited/cancelled (in shares)
|814,357
|Expired (in shares)
|213,901
|Exercised (in shares)
|191,342
|2012 Plan | Restricted stock units
|Stock-based compensation
|Granted (in shares)
|556,432
|Forfeited (in shares)
|87,458
|Vested (in shares)
|455,878
|Incentive Plan 2021 New Shares [Member]
|Stock-based compensation
|Number of shares reserved
|887,489
|X
- Definition
+ References
The number of equity-based payment instruments, excluding stock (or unit) options, that were forfeited during the reporting period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of grants made during the period on other than stock (or unit) option plans (for example, phantom stock or unit plan, stock or unit appreciation rights plan, performance target plan).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of equity-based payment instruments, excluding stock (or unit) options, that vested during the reporting period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of additional shares authorized for issuance under share-based payment arrangement.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ares authorized for issuance under share-based payment arrangement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
The difference between the maximum number of shares (or other type of equity) authorized for issuance under the plan (including the effects of amendments and adjustments), and the sum of: 1) the number of shares (or other type of equity) already issued upon exercise of options or other equity-based awards under the plan; and 2) shares (or other type of equity) reserved for issuance on granting of outstanding awards, net of cancellations and forfeitures, if applicable.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of options or other stock instruments for which the right to exercise has lapsed under the terms of the plan agreements.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
The number of shares under options that were cancelled during the reporting period as a result of occurrence of a terminating event specified in contractual agreements pertaining to the stock option plan.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Gross number of share options (or share units) granted during the period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of share options (or share units) exercised during the current period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Represents the number of equity compensation plans of the entity.
+ Details
No definition available.
|X
- Definition
+ References
Reduction of shares available for issuance.
+ Details
No definition available.
|X
- Definition
+ References
Represents the annual increase in the maximum number of shares (or other type of equity) that was initially approved (usually by shareholders and board of directors), net of any subsequent amendments and adjustments, for awards under the equity-based compensation plan.
+ Details
No definition available.
|X
- Definition
+ References
Represents the percentage of the number of shares of outstanding stock relating to determining the annual increase in the maximum number of shares available for issuance under the plan.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details